Where endpoint estates drift
- Ad-hoc device choice by role
New hires and refreshes are ordered by request rather than to a persona catalogue, so specifications, accessories and warranty terms differ across the same job family.
- Multiple images and inconsistent baselines
Legacy imaging by region or business unit leaves patch levels, encryption posture and application baselines out of alignment across the estate.
- Manual joiner-mover-leaver workflows
Devices are handed out and reclaimed manually, so onboarding time is unpredictable and leaver equipment lingers outside asset records.
- No feedback loop on user experience
Boot time, application reliability and network quality are not measured, so investment is directed at symptoms rather than root causes.
Delivery approach
A multi-vendor EUC lifecycle covering assessment, persona-based standards, phased procurement and provisioning, and ongoing endpoint operations.
- 01Assess
Review current endpoint estate, images, personas, application portfolio, warranty burn rate, procurement contracts and Digital Employee Experience signals.
- 02Design
Define a persona-based device catalogue, image and baseline standards, application delivery model, refresh calendar and governance model.
- 03Implement
Coordinate procurement, staging, zero-touch enrolment, migration and application delivery in controlled waves by persona and site with documented acceptance.
- 04Operate & Optimise
Support the endpoint estate under an agreed schedule with patch, compliance, DEX analytics, refresh planning and scheduled service reviews.
